Description

Experts are warning people watching the U.S. election to be prepared for a deluge of disinformation. Today, This Matters looks at two perspectives that Star reporters have recently covered regarding this huge problem. Alex McKeen joins to talk about the surprising role Canadian’s play in creating and sharing disinformation, and then, Douglas Quans tells us what online platforms like Facebook and Twitter are doing to fight misinformation.

The world is changing every day. Now, more than ever, these questions matter. What’s happening? And why should you care? This Matters, a daily news podcast from the Toronto Star, aims to answer those questions, on important stories and ideas, every day, Monday to Friday. Hosts Saba Eitizaz and Raju Mudhar talk to experts and newsmakers about the social, cultural, political and economic stories that shape your life.
